Does Leica Q2 have image stabilization?

In addition to the tank-like exterior, it boasts a 47.3MP full frame sensor in addition to a high resolution EVF. The focal length is still a 28mm f1. 7 lens but this time it is not only weather sealed but offers optical image stabilization. The camera can also shoot at 10fps to help you capture the decisive moment..

Is Leica Q2 durable?

The Leica Q2 is rated to IP52 when it comes to weather sealing. This isn’t as robust as the Olympus OMD EM1X; but it is still very durable. Photographers who take it to shoot in the rain shouldn’t fear at all as you’ll be able to combine the lens’s great quality with the camera’s overall durability.

Is Leica Q2 waterproof? You don’t have to worry about shooting in inclement weather when wielding the Q2, as it is coated with a special weather sealing to ensure protection from water, dust and other debris. The camera is being marketed as the only model in its class to withstand such outside elements.

Is Leica Q2 better than Q?

The image quality of Leica Q2 (70) is superior to that of Leica Q (66). Leica Q2 (52) performs better than Leica Q (40) in terms of speed. Leica Q2 is more versatile than Leica Q (82 a 68). The handling of Leica Q (66) is more effective than that of Leica Q2 (52).

Is Leica fotos free?

Leica’s FOTOS app is now free for all after the $50/year ‘Pro’ subscription was removed. Last month, Leica quietly announced in the changelog of the version 2.2. 0 update of its FOTOS mobile app that it was making all ‘FOTOS PRO’ features available for free to all users.

How do I transfer photos from my digital camera to my laptop?

To import pictures and videos from a digital camera

  1. Connect the camera to your computer by using the camera’s USB cable.
  2. Turn on the camera.
  3. In the AutoPlay dialog box that appears, click Import pictures and videos using Windows.
  4. (Optional) To tag the pictures, type a tag name in the Tag these pictures (optional) box.

How do I import photos from my camera to Windows 10?

If you are accustomed to importing photos using the Import Pictures and Videos wizard, you can still do so in Windows 10. Click Start > File Explorer > This PC. You should see the camera appear under Devices. Right click it then click Import pictures and videos.

Does Leica Q2 have zoom? The Q2 comes with a built-in fixed 28mm lens with 1.7 aperture. It has the versatility of a cropping mechanism that increases its flexibility when composing shots at 28mm, 50mm and 72mm. This eliminates the need for a zoom lens — almost meeting the level of a wide-angle lens.
